Tucson, AZ (January 16, 2025) – Emergency responders were dispatched to the scene of a crash with reported injuries at the intersection of Stone Ave and Rillito St early Thursday morning. The accident occurred at approximately 1:49 a.m., involving multiple vehicles.
First responders arrived promptly to provide medical assistance to those injured in the collision. The extent of the injuries and the number of people involved have not been disclosed at this time. Authorities worked to manage traffic in the area while conducting their investigation.
The cause of the crash is still under review as officials gather more details. Our thoughts are with the individuals affected by this incident, and we wish them a full recovery.
Car Accidents in Arizona
Arizona’s roadways, particularly in busy cities like Tucson, frequently see collisions at intersections such as Stone Ave and Rillito St. Factors like distracted driving, speeding, and failure to yield are common contributors to these accidents.
Early morning crashes are especially risky due to reduced visibility and driver fatigue. Such incidents emphasize the importance of cautious driving, especially at intersections or areas with high traffic density.
For individuals involved in accidents, seeking medical attention, documenting the scene, and understanding their rights are crucial steps. These actions can aid in physical recovery and provide the necessary support to navigate insurance claims or legal processes.
